Esh Construction To Improve Walking And Cycling Access In Elland And West Vale

Construction News Image
Plans to improve walking and cycling access around Elland and West Vale have taken a significant step forward with Esh Construction appointed to finalise the detailed designs for the Elland Access Package in collaboration with Calderdale Council.

Approved by planners in November 2024, the designs for the project will soon be submitted to the West Yorkshire Combined Authority for final approval. The development will create new walking and cycling routes connecting Elland town centre to West Vale, Greetland and Exley, while also including the construction of two new pedestrian and cycle bridges over the River Calder and the Calder and Hebble Navigation.

The project aims to improve safety and accessibility for pedestrians and cyclists, with upgrades to existing routes and public spaces, as well as the installation of new lighting and landscaping. The Elland Access Package will also support access to the planned Elland Rail Station, providing safer and more convenient travel options for local communities.

Procured through the YORhub's YORcivil3 framework, the project will be funded through a partnership between the West Yorkshire Combined Authority and Calderdale Council, with additional support from the Transforming Cities Fund. This initiative forms part of the larger Elland Rail Station and Access Package aimed at improving transportation links and boosting local connectivity in the region.
